Q: Is 25,676,370 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 25,676,370 is not a prime number.

Why is 25,676,370 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 25676370 can be evenly divided by 1 2 3 5 6 9 10 15 18 30 31 45 62 90 93 155 186 279 310 465 558 930 1,395 2,790 9,203 18,406 27,609 46,015 55,218 82,827 92,030 138,045 165,654 276,090 285,293 414,135 570,586 828,270 855,879 1,426,465 1,711,758 2,567,637 2,852,930 4,279,395 5,135,274 8,558,790 12,838,185 and 25,676,370, with no remainder.

Since 25,676,370 cannot be divided by just 1 and 25,676,370, it is not a prime number.
